With no GPS or sonar radar, they have to rely on constant guidance and step-by-step commands from the mother ship (eg- ”Go straight ahead about 50 meters, okay now take a left, you’re right there” ). Bear in mind it’s pitch-black down there and although the Titan has both interior and exterior lights they have to be shut off frequently to conserve electrical power. Also the vessel’s crush depth is just a hair over 13,000 feet and the Titanic wreckage lies at 12,500, which is flirting dangerously close to the limits of the vessel’s structural integrity (for example they could land on the ocean floor miles from the actual wreckage site and wind up in some underwater canyon at an even greater depth and there goes the whole ballgame) This whole expedition was such a crazy and stupid idea from the very beginning.
